2026 FIFA WCQ: Ghana pins down Mali 1:0

Ghana has bested Mali 1:0 at the Accra (Ohene Gyan) Sports Stadium.
The 2026 FIFA World Cup Qualifiers (WCQ) match took place on Monday, September 8, 2025, starting at 7 PM.
The only goal of the match came from Ghana Black Stars' Alexander Djiku in the 49th minute, via Jordan Ayew's inswinging corner.
Ghana continues its lead of Group I but now with 19 points.
Led by Coach Otto Addo, the Black Stars have an away game against Central African Republic. Thereafter, the team hosts Comoros. The team needs just a win from the two encounters to return to the World Cup.
